Whether a custom will flow better is really dependent on what kind of exhaust you're running. A lot of the Apexi/HKS/etc exhausts are designed to be run with the stock cat in place. The Apexi N1 for example is designed to be used in the N1 class, which requires the stock cat. It thus is bottle necked at the catylitic converter and becomes a restriction. If you're running a 3" open exhaust, either racing beat or custom is the way to go, to ensure you're really getting 3" all the way through.
